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5306 0843201448 5118915
5867058 495 34763
5867058 495 34763
93552 87555508181 400266109
All about undefined
Interested in learning more?
5867058 495 34763
93552 87555508181 400266109
See more
19714844283 3261373740
46 733 69
See more
078066214 60437288645 817447983
37794238398 730289 49727 0887030629
See more